ホームページ > ウェブフロントエンド > フロントエンドQ&A > JavaScriptに最適なコンパイラは何ですか?

JavaScriptに最適なコンパイラは何ですか?

PHPz
リリース: 2023-04-19 14:47:11
オリジナル
1166 人が閲覧しました

JavaScript は、最新の Web アプリケーションやモバイル アプリケーションで大きな応用価値を持つ、広く使用されているプログラミング言語です。したがって、開発プロセスの効率を向上させ、作業負荷を軽減できる、自分に合った JavaScript コンパイラーを選択することが非常に重要です。ただし、開発者のニーズや好みはそれぞれ異なるため、最適な JavaScript コンパイラーを見つけるのは簡単ではありません。

無料および有料のオプションを含め、選択できる JavaScript コンパイラーは数多くあります。この記事では、開発者がより良い選択をできるよう、最適な JavaScript コンパイラーを検討します。

  1. Visual Studio Code

Visual Studio Code は、Web およびモバイル アプリケーション開発に広く使用されている軽量のコード エディターです。 Microsoft によって開発されたこのエディタには、コードの自動補完、構文の強調表示、デバッグ、バージョン管理などの強力な機能が備わっています。 Visual Studio Code は、開発者が JavaScript コードをより適切に作成できるようにする拡張機能とプラグインの豊富なライブラリも提供します。

  1. Sublime Text

Sublime Text は、多くの開発者に愛されているフル機能のテキスト エディターです。 JavaScript だけでなく、他の多くのプログラミング言語もサポートしています。 Sublime Text の利点は速度と使いやすさにあるため、JavaScript 開発に最適なエディタの 1 つと考えられています。

  1. Atom

Atom は、GitHub によって開発された無料のオープンソース テキスト エディターです。 Atom は、構文チェック、コードの折りたたみ、デバッグ、バージョン管理などの機能をサポートし、さまざまな開発ニーズを満たすための広範なプラグイン ライブラリも提供します。 Atom の利点は、その柔軟性と個人の好みに合わせてカスタマイズできることです。

  1. Brackets

Brackets は、Web 開発者向けに特別に設計された無料のオープンソース テキスト エディタです。ライブ プレビューや多言語サポートなど、多くの Web 開発機能が付属しています。 Brackets には、オートコンプリート、コードの折りたたみ、エディター テーマなどの基本的な機能も付属しています。

  1. WebStorm

WebStorm は、JetBrains によって開発された強力な JavaScript コンパイラーです。強力なデバッグ機能と自動補完機能があり、多数のプラグインと拡張機能も提供します。 WebStorm には、コードの最適化、構文チェック、グラフィカル ユーザー インターフェイス ツールなどの高度な機能もあります。

  1. Eclipse

Eclipse は、JavaScript などの複数のプログラミング言語をサポートする、広く使用されているオープン ソース IDE です。 Eclipse には、強力なデバッグ、コード リファクタリング、バージョン管理、自動化機能があります。 Eclipse は、さまざまな開発ニーズを満たすプラグインと拡張機能もサポートしています。

つまり、自分に合った JavaScript コンパイラーを選択することが非常に重要です。上記の JavaScript コンパイラはどれも非常に優れた選択肢ですが、最終的な選択は個人のニーズと好みによって決まります。開発者は、さまざまな JavaScript コンパイラーを使用する前に比較およびテストし、最適なエディターを見つけることをお勧めします。

以上がJavaScriptに最適なコンパイラは何です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ート